Fortinet built its reputation on security, FortiGate is one of the world's most deployed next-generation firewalls. Its Secure Networking portfolio extends that security DNA into FortiSwitch, FortiAP, and SD-WAN, all unified through FortiOS and the Fortinet Security Fabric so policy and threat protection span the whole environment.
Networking is delivered through a security lens rather than as a standalone managed service. Hardware is purchased as CapEx, licensing runs through FortiCare and FortiGuard subscriptions (with consumption-based FortiFlex available), and the platform is operated by your team or an MSSP. It's a powerful choice where security and networking must come from one fabric.
